国产成人精品亚洲777人妖,欧美日韩精品一区视频,最新亚洲国产,国产乱码精品一区二区亚洲

您的位置:首頁技術文章
文章詳情頁

IDEA連接MySQL提示serverTimezone的問題及解決方法

瀏覽:134日期:2023-10-18 08:28:40

今天,在使用IDEA軟件連接MySQL數據庫時,一直報時區相關的錯誤(其實吧,以前也遇到過這個錯誤)

錯誤:

Server returns invalid timezone. Go to ’Advanced’ tab and set ’serverTimezone’ property manually.

錯誤頁面:

IDEA連接MySQL提示serverTimezone的問題及解決方法

解決辦法一

之前的解決辦法是:“Data Sources and Drivers” ~ “General” ~ “URL” 中指明 'serverTimezone'的值為 “UTC” ,這樣,就可以成功連上數據庫了

將下列代碼復制到 “Data Sources and Drivers” ~ “General” ~ “URL” 輸入框中

jdbc:mysql://localhost:3306/blog?useUnicode=true&characterEncoding=utf-8&allowPublicKeyRetrieval=true&serverTimezone=UTC&useSSL=false

IDEA連接MySQL提示serverTimezone的問題及解決方法

解決辦法二

但是,每次都要把'serverTimezone'= 'UTC'填充到 “Data Sources and Drivers” ~ “General” ~ “URL” 輸入框中,著實很麻煩,下面介紹一個可能是“一勞永逸”的方法(不敢太確定,只是目前本小白就遇到了上述所說的bug,不知道對于本小白未知的bug,這種方法是否可以解決;如果有機會,很高興能和各位大佬一起討論各種各樣的bug):

在 “Data Sources and Drivers” ~ “Advanced” 中設置

Name Value serverTimezone Asia/Shanghai

IDEA連接MySQL提示serverTimezone的問題及解決方法

回到 “Data Sources and Drivers” ~ “General” , 測試連接,連接成功;

IDEA連接MySQL提示serverTimezone的問題及解決方法

解決辦法三

打開mysql操作窗口,連接上mysql,設置timezone:

輸入以下mysql指令:show variables like ‘%time_zone%’;

show variables like ’%time_zone%’;

IDEA連接MySQL提示serverTimezone的問題及解決方法

默認的 time_zone = “SYSTEM”; 在此,我們修改time_zone的值:set global time_zone = “+8:00”;

set global time_zone = '+8:00';

注意:設置完 “time_zone” ,需要打開另外一個mysql操作窗口,可以查看修改后的 “time_zone” ;

IDEA連接MySQL提示serverTimezone的問題及解決方法

數據庫連接成功:

IDEA連接MySQL提示serverTimezone的問題及解決方法

如果有其它問題,很榮幸能和各位大佬一起探討!

以上就是IDEA連接MySQL提示serverTimezone的問題及解決方法的詳細內容,更多關于IDEA連接MySQL serverTimezone的資料請關注好吧啦網其它相關文章!

標簽: MySQL 數據庫
相關文章:
主站蜘蛛池模板: 清流县| 澄迈县| 无棣县| 屏山县| 阿克苏市| 井冈山市| 山东省| 留坝县| 开封县| 连山| 临桂县| 易门县| 江源县| 阳原县| 华宁县| 海淀区| 江陵县| 天水市| 仙居县| 淮北市| 建昌县| 新宁县| 柳河县| 吉木萨尔县| 蒲江县| 南安市| 安新县| 宽甸| 遂平县| 汤阴县| 孟连| 重庆市| 尖扎县| 淮阳县| 固安县| 通河县| 顺昌县| 平顶山市| 工布江达县| 永修县| 汤阴县|